Summary: When Soviet intelligence takes Castro under its wing, the CIA's response is to send in ex-Marine hero Earl Swagger, and in Cuba, Earl finds himself up to his neck in treacherous ambiguity, where the old rules about honor and duty don't apply.

Summary: Reclaiming a lost military sword for a Japanese war veteran, Bob Lee Swagger is forced to postpone his retirement when a self-proclaimed samurai brutally murders the veteran's family, a crime Swagger vows to avenge.

Summary: July, 1944: The lush, rolling hills of Normandy are dotted with a new feature--German snipers. From their vantage points, they pick off hundreds of Allied soldiers every day, bringing the D-Day invasion to its knees. It's clear that someone is tipping off these snipers with the locations of American GIs, but who? And how? General Eisenhower demands his intelligence service to find the best shot...
